Key Skills and Qualifications for Accountants in the UAE
Employers seek candidates with a blend of academic credentials, practical experience, and soft skills. The typical requirements include:
- Educational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related fields; CPA, ACCA, CMA certification is highly advantageous.
- Experience: At least 2-5 years of relevant experience in financial reporting, audit, taxation, or management accounting.
- Technical Skills: Proficiency in ERP systems (SAP, Oracle), MS Excel, and accounting software.
- Knowledge of UAE Financial Regulations: Familiarity with VAT, corporate tax laws, and local compliance standards.
- Language Skills: Fluency in English is essential; Arabic language skills can be an added advantage.
- Soft Skills: Attention to detail, analytical thinking, strong communication abilities, and integrity are crucial traits.

Top Employers Offering Accountant Positions in UAE
Many renowned organizations actively seek qualified accountants. These include:
- Multinational Financial Institutions: HSBC, Citibank, Standard Chartered
- Major Real Estate Developers: Emaar Properties, DAMAC Properties
- Government Agencies: Dubai Financial Market, Abu Dhabi Securities Exchange
- Consulting and Advisory Firms: Deloitte, PwC, KPMG
- Local Conglomerates: Al-Futtaim Group, LuLu Group International

Future Outlook for Accountants in the UAE
The demand for proficient accountants in the UAE is projected to continue rising, driven by government initiatives focusing on economic diversification and digital transformation. Technology-driven accounting tools and compliance standards are also evolving, requiring professionals to continually upgrade their skills.
Moreover, with the recent enhancements in financial regulations, such as the introduction of VAT and other compliance requirements, accountants with regional expertise are increasingly sought after. This trend ensures long-term stability and growth prospects within the sector.
